Pieta provides free, accessible one-to-one counselling to people suffering from suicidal ideation, engaging in self-harm or to those bereaved by suicide. With 270 qualified Therapists and support staff across 15 centres and 5 outreach, Pieta’s work ensures that help is available to those in crisis.

Pieta' vision is a world where suicide, self-harm and stigma have been replaced by hope, self-care and acceptance. By supporting us you will allow us to strive to make this a reality. Without your support we would not have been able to give hope to over 50,000 people since we first opened our doors in 2006.All of our services (one-to-one counselling, 24 hour helpline, SBLO Service, Training and Education) are provided free of charge.
